The US-China AI Competition: Collaboration or Conflict?

The rapid progression of artificial intelligence (AI) has placed the United States and China at the forefront of a global technological competition. Both nations are heavily investing resources to develop cutting-edge AI technologies, fueled by a desire for both economic leadership and strategic power. Some argue that this AI contest could lead to an intensifying geopolitical conflict, with possible consequences for global stability. Conversely, others propose that increased collaboration between the US and China in the field of AI could yield unprecedented progresses for humanity. The path forward remains uncertain, hinging on the choices made by both nations.
